Theodore D.R. Green

Webster University (MO)

Ted D. R. Green, Ph. D. is a Professor in the Teacher Education Department, School of Education at Webster University. Green just published a book Oh Freedom After While: The 1939 Missouri Sharecropper Protest that supports the documentary of the same name. Currently Green is serving in his 4th year on the NCHE Board. He is the Chair of the Professional Development Committee. He has also been a consultant on more than 35 TAH Grants in the United States and 5 TAH Grants in the St. Louis metro area. Green works with the National Park Service training park rangers and assisting with curriculum. Recently Green completed a Fellowship in the Netherlands, where he studied in Leiden, and taught classes on International Education and Dutch History. Green continues to work for the Colonial Williamsburg Foundation, where he has been writing curriculum and training educators for over twenty years.
